About Schletter Canada

A global manufacturer of solar mounting systems and metal fabrication.

company building

Company History

The Schletter name encompasses over 40 years of experience in the design and manufacturing of steel and aluminum products. In the last five years Schletter’s 1,500 employees have globally designed, developed and produced solar mounting systems for more than 15 GW of installed module capacity on roofs and ground mounted systems.

In 2010, the Schletter Canada manufacturing facility was opened in Windsor, Ontario and has since delivered the mounting systems for over 3,000 solar projects in Canada.


We Can Help You. Call Us (+1) 778 229 2956

Contact us for a Free Remote Quote and Site Survey